Look, there are tons of mangoes growing!

Literal

Look mango [subj-が] lots are-bearing [emph-よ].

なる here is the verb 'to bear (fruit),' not the more familiar 'to become' — context (fruit on a tree) disambiguates. ~ている marks the resulting state ('they have grown and are now hanging there'), a classic change-of-state use of ~ている. The opening ほら 'look / hey' is an attention-grabbing interjection used when showing someone something.
